Historical Significance and Landmarks
The Donkin Reserve is named after Sir Rufane Donkin, the acting Governor of the Cape Colony, who commissioned a memorial pyramid in memory of his late wife, Elizabeth. This pyramid stands as a prominent feature of the reserve, offering panoramic views of the city and Algoa Bay. Furthermore, the reserve features a stone obelisk commemorating the landing of the 1820 settlers, as well as various other historical monuments and statues that narrate the story of Port Elizabeth’s colonial past. For those keen on delving deeper into the city’s historical roots, the Donkin Reserve provides an invaluable starting point. Additionally, a walking tour of the reserve allows visitors to appreciate the architectural details and the stories behind each monument.

Beyond its historical landmarks, the Donkin Reserve also serves as a cultural hub. The colorful Route 67, an art route comprising 67 public artworks symbolizing Nelson Mandela’s 67 years of service, starts here and winds its way through the city. Consequently, visitors can immerse themselves in contemporary South African art while exploring the historical sites. What to Expect on a Marine Eco Tour
Marine eco-tours typically involve a guided boat trip along the coast, led by knowledgeable experts who provide insights into the marine life and ecological significance of the area. During the tour, you can expect to see playful bottlenose dolphins surfing the waves, humpback whales migrating during specific seasons, and Cape fur seals basking on rocky outcrops. In addition, various seabirds, such as gannets and penguins, can be spotted diving for fish. Furthermore, the guides will offer valuable information about the behaviors, habitats, and conservation challenges faced by these animals. Key Attractions and Activities
One of the main draws of Cape Recife is its exceptional birdlife. As a significant bird migration point, the reserve attracts numerous species, making it a paradise for ornithologists and casual bird enthusiasts alike. Furthermore, the Sacramento Trail, a popular hiking route, meanders through the reserve, offering stunning views of the coastline and the chance to spot various seabirds and marine life. Don’t forget to visit the historic lighthouse, which not only serves as a navigational aid but also provides panoramic views of Algoa Bay.
